Mornings are your thing. You love creating great first impressions, enjoy chatting with guests, and know that a fantastic breakfast can set the tone for an unforgettable stay. We're looking for a Breakfast Waiter to join our team for 25 hours per week, working 5 days out of 7. You'll be part of a friendly team delivering warm, attentive service and helping our guests start their day in the best possible way.

What you'll be doing:

  • Welcoming guests with a smile and providing exceptional service from 7am to 12pm or 8am to 1pm work day
  • Taking food and drink orders and serving breakfast efficiently
  • Setting up and preparing the restaurant each morning
  • Keeping service areas clean, organised and well-stocked
  • Working closely with the kitchen team to ensure smooth service
  • Creating memorable experiences for every guest

What we're looking for:

  • A positive, friendly and reliable personality
  • Great communication skills and a genuine passion for hospitality
  • Someone who enjoys working as part of a team
  • Previous restaurant or hotel experience is helpful but not essential
  • Flexibility to work weekends and bank holidays as part of a rota

How to prepare for a job interview at Homewood

Know Your Breakfast Menu

Familiarise yourself with the breakfast menu and any specials. Being able to confidently discuss the dishes and recommend items will impress your interviewers and show your passion for the role.

Show Off Your People Skills

Since this role is all about creating great first impressions, practice your communication skills. Be ready to share examples of how you've made guests feel welcome in previous roles or even in everyday situations.

Demonstrate Team Spirit

This position requires working closely with a team, so be prepared to talk about your experiences in collaborative environments. Highlight times when you’ve supported colleagues or contributed to a positive team atmosphere.

Embrace Flexibility

The job requires flexibility with hours, including weekends and bank holidays. Be honest about your availability and express your willingness to adapt to the needs of the team, which will show your commitment to the role.
